"The Girl on a Motorcycle"

About the Item

Original Japanese film poster from the 1968 film “The Girl on a Motorcycle”. The Art work on this Japanese poster is unique to the films Japans release. The film starred Marianne Faithfull, Alain Delon and was directed by Jack Cardiff. The poster is conservation linen backed and would be shipped rolled in a strong tube.

Elvis 'Girls! Girls! Girls!' Original Vintage Japanese B2 Movie Poster, 1963
Located in Devon, GB
Following the tried and tested golden formula of light-hearted musical entertainment, exotic location and girls galore which saw Elvis' soundtrack albums far outstrip his regular album sales, 'Girls! Girls! Girls!' stands out as one of Elvis Presley's more popular films, even receiving a Golden Globe nomination for Best Motion Picture - Musical. Elvis' eleventh feature film and his second shot in Hawaii, 'Girls! Girls! Girls!' was a safe money-spinner for both his record label RCA and the film's distributor Paramount, who saw Elvis voted as 1962's 'Top Box Office Draw' for having three of the top grossing films of that year. The highlight of the film is Presley's performance of his enduring pop classic 'Return to Sender,' which subsequently peaked at no.2 on the US Billboard chart when released as the lead single from the soundtrack album. Seen in sublime profile, Elvis is every inch the handsome heartthrob as the penniless fishing boat pilot on this ultra rare B2 poster for the original Japanese release. Completing one of the best poster designs we have seen for this picture, a bevy of bikini-clad beauties feature at the foot of the photomontage, with Elvis as the carefree sailor sandwiched between his two love interests, played by Stella Stevens...

The Life of a Forgotten Magicians
Located in London, GB
The Life of a Forgotten Magicians We are proud to offer a unique collection of one of London’s most unquestionably entertaining magicians known as Bernard and Ms Radar. A fascinating collection of 1940s-1960s items relating to the telepathic magic act 'Bernard and Miss Radar', a mind reading husband and wife duo, who extensively toured British theatres performing their telepathy based act and who were apparently the recipients of the 'World Convention of Magicians Award', which they received at the Magic Circle Convention in London in 1955. The collection comprises the basis for their act; 2 large handmade jigsaw puzzles, a “Radar” hat, top hat and other associated items with which they performed. There is also a large quantity (over 1000) of publicity photographs, theatre contracts, Magic Circle programmes, scrapbooks and other ephemera relating to their career, plus approximately fifteen original 1940s and 1950s theatre and other posters and several hand bills and flyers, all including Bernard and Miss Radar on the billing, along with other variety acts of the period. Some of the theatre posters included are; The Hippodrome, Eastbourne, Arcadia Theatre, Skegness, Commodore, Ryde, The Knightstone, Weston-Super-Mare and The Palace Theatre, Reading, which now all been framed to preserve them for display.
